On Wed, Aug 11, 2021 at 8:27 AM Aaron Conole <aconole at redhat.com> wrote:

> Timothy Redaelli <tredaelli at redhat.com> writes:
>
> > Currently, there are some patches with the tags wrongly written (with
> > space instead of dash ) and this may prevent some automatic system or CI
> > to detect them correctly.
> >
> > This commit adds a check in checkpatch to be sure the tag is written
> > correctly with dash and not with space.
> >
> > The tags supported by the commit are:
> > Reported-by, Requested-by, Suggested-by, Reported-at, and Submitted-at
> >
> > It's not necessary to add "Signed-off-by" since it's already checked in
> > checkpatch.
> >
> > Signed-off-by: Timothy Redaelli <tredaelli at redhat.com>
> > ---
>
> Hi Timothy - thanks for this patch!
>
> There's some flake8 errors introduced here.  Python doesn't like
> aligning the entities inside the corrections array (for some crazy
> reason).
>
>   utilities/checkpatch.py:753:26: E241 multiple spaces after ':'
>   utilities/checkpatch.py:756:26: E241 multiple spaces after ':'
>
> With those fixed -
>
> Acked-by: Aaron Conole <aconole at redhat.com>
>
> CC'd Sal - looks like the recent change introduced for multiple workflow
> support broke the way we report errors.  At the very least, we have an
> error message and link to the failing builds, but the actual step
> failures isn't included.
